The Wisdom Seat in Rosewood is a bench seat provided by the Rosewood Shire Council for residents to wait for their mail. The Rosewood CWA required the Rosewood Shire Council to provide a seat in 1929. The seat was for the convenience of residents waiting outside the Post Office for the arrival of the mail. … Read more

Johnston Park is a parkland named after Archibald Wilfred Johnston, commonly known as ‘Wilf’, a councillor of Rosewood Shire Council from 1946 to 1949. Rosewood Shire Council amalgamated in 1949 into the new Moreton Shire Council, where Wilf became the first chairman until 1952, and served again between 1955 and 1958. Das Neumann Haus is a house museum in the country town of Laidley. Built in 1893 by German immigrant Hermann Newmann, it has been refurnished in the style of the 1930s. Lake Dyer is near Laidley, an offstream storage dam providing water for irrigation, filled mainly from diverted flows from Laidley Creek as demand requires.
